The calculator uses this ISO-standard equation:
Weight = [A² – (A – 2t)²] × Length × Density
Where:
A = Outer dimension (side length)
t = Wall thickness
Length = Pipe length
All inputs convert to meters using these factors:
Unit | Conversion Factor |
---|---|
mm | × 0.001 |
cm | × 0.01 |
m | × 1 |
in | × 0.0254 |
ft | × 0.3048 |
Material | Density (kg/m³) | Standard |
---|---|---|
Mild Steel | 7850 | ASTM A36 |
Stainless Steel | 8030 | ASTM A240 |
Aluminum | 2720 | ASTM B209 |
Copper | 8940 | ASTM B152 |
Titanium | 4500 | ASTM B348 |
